On 7/20/2022 7:40 AM, Michal Wilczynski wrote:
> For performance reasons there is a need to have support for selectable
> tx scheduler topology. Currently firmware supports only the default
> 9-layer and 5-layer topology. This patch series enables switch from
> default to 5-layer topology, if user decides to opt-in.

Are you using next-queue/dev-queue[1] to base these patches on? These 
are not applying, however, they do appear to apply to net-next as lkp is 
able to apply them to that tree[2]. Please use net-queue or next-queue 
if you are sending patches for IWL.
